WebJan 29, 2024 · Live cell imaging revealed that CCF are generated by a nucleus-to-cytoplasm blebbing of chromatin through the nuclear … WebMay 19, 2005 · Here, we use cell blebs as reporters of local pressure in the cytoplasm. When we locally perfuse blebbing cells with cortex-relaxing drugs to dissipate pressure on one side, blebbing continues on the untreated side, implying non-equilibration of pressure on scales of approximately 10 microm and 10 s.

WebCytochemistry Myeloblasts stain diffuse pale red–purple in the PAS reaction and there may sometimes also be a fine granular positivity. They are Sudan black- and MPO-negative and, usually, alpha-naphthol AS-D chloroacetate esterase-negative. Blasts are not usually present in the peripheral blood; their presence in the circulation is highly abnormal and classically suggestive of acute leukaemia.
